WHO: Paris Saint-Germain (PSG) vs Arsenal
Contents: UEFA Champions League semi-finals, second leg
Location: Paris Princess, Paris, France
When: Wednesday at 9pm (19:00 GMT)

Follow the Al Jazeera Sport’s live text and photo commentary stream.

PSG and Arsenal continue their quest to win the Maiden UEFA Champions League title when they clash in the second round of the Paris semi-finals.

PSG’s away victory over the gunners in the opening leg of Emirates Stadium on April 29th has strengthened the Parisian as a favourite for their progress to the Finals.

The Gunners face the difficult challenge of having to beat the French champions on the road on Wednesday if they want to reach the Champions League final for the second time in history.

Here’s all to know before the semi-finals between the two most talented football clubs in Europe.

What happened to the legs at the opening?

PSG took a big step to reach the final when Osmandembele’s early goal sealed a 1-0 victory at Arsenal in the tense Game 1 of the semi-finals.

Dembele fired the house from the post in four minutes as PSG dominated the opening stage, and manager Luis Enrique’s team had valuable advantages for the French capital.

When did Arsenal and PSG reach the UEFA Champions League final?

Neither team has won the best football competition in Europe, but both have lost the finals.

PSG made its only final appearance in the 2019-2020 season, losing 1-0 to Germany’s Bayern Munich at Estadiodals in Lisbon, Portugal.

Arsenal’s participation in the UEFA Champions League Finals was 19 years ago for Gunners fans, losing to Barcelona 2-1 at Stade de France in France in San Denis, France in the 2005-2006 season.

Team News: PSG

Star striker Dembele is well worthy of playing in the return leg, limping in minor hamstring tension after winning the match against Arsenal in London’s first leg, Enrique said Tuesday.

The 27-year-old Dembele is the top PSG goalscorer this season, scoring 33 goals in all competitions.

The PSG regular team has not been injured by Desies Doue, who was tilted to re-enter the role of an offensive winger at the expense of French international Bradleavercola.

Ousmane Dembele in Action.
PSG’s French forward #10 Ousmane Dembele, next to manager Louis Enrique, will be taking part in a training session with Arsenal in the second leg of the semi-final UEFA Champions League match on May 6, 2025 at the club’s training ground in Poissy, west of Paris. [Franck Fife/AFP]

Team News: Arsenal

Major midfielder Thomas Party sits the first leg against PSG on the suspension before returning to the side and restores manager Mikel Arteta’s priority midfield trio along with Declan Rice and Martin Odegard.

Jurrien Timber is suspicious of this match as he continues to fight back to full fitness after a knee injury. But some good news for the club is that the Dutch defender was trained with the Gunners team just before his departure for France on Tuesday.

Bystanders Kai Herberts, Ricardo Carafioli and Giorguinho are all likely to play by the end of the Premier League season, but unless Arsenal reaches the finals at the end of May, they are not competing for Champions League choices.

Gabriel, Gabriel Jesus and Touhiro Tomiyas are all out until next season.

Jurrien Timber and Thomas Partey are active.
Arsenal’s Dutch Defender #12 Julientimber, left, Ghana’s midfielder #5 Thomas Party will be taking part in a team training session held at London Corney, north of London on May 6, 2025. [Glyn Kirk/AFP]

Possible lineup:

Arsenal Possible XI: Raya; Wood, Saliva, Kiwior, Lewis Skelly. Part, Rice, Odegard; Saka, Merino, Martinelli

PSG-enabled XI: Donnarumma; Hakimi, Marquinhos, Pacho, Nuno Mendes; Vicinha, Fabian Lewis, Joan Neves. Kvaratskhelia, Dembele, Doue

Head-on:

The team has played six times in all competitions previously.

Arsenal Victory: 3 PSG Victory: 1 Draw: 2

What the manager had to say:

Arsenal’s Arteta: “If you want to participate in the Champions League final, you have to do something special. You have to do something special in Paris.”

PSG’s Enrique: “We’re going to suffer because our opponents don’t have a positive outcome. We need to match performances as closely as possible on the first leg.

When and where will the 2025 UEFA Champions League Finals be?

The winner of this semi-final will head to Germany on May 31 for the Champions League final.

The largest annual exhibition of European football takes place at the Allianz Arena, 75,000 capacity in Munich.
